Police are investigating the rape of a woman in Glasgow city centre in the early hours of the morning.
The 24-year-old was assaulted in Brunswick Street, in the Merchant City area, early today.
Part of the street has been cordoned off and officers remain at the scene.
Police said they received a report of a serious sexual assault and that inquiries are continuing. Further details on the incident are yet to be released.
